These are the settings provided to me to fix my LED Tail Lights in Forscan:

BRONCO FORSCAN SETTINGS FOR ORACLE FLUSH MOUNT TAIL LIGHTS – LED REPLACEMENTS

You will need to use FORSCAN to update the BdyCM (Body Control Module) settings if you have the Signature LED tail lights. There are two different procedures, one without the Amber drop-ins and one with the Amber drop-ins.

For Oracle Tail Lights Without Amber Drop Ins:

FunctionOriginal ValueNew Value
Left Rear Stop and Position Lamp UsageNot UsedStop and Turn
Left Rear Turn Lamp UsageStop and TurnNot Used
Right Rear Stop and Position Lamp UsageNot UsedStop and Turn
Right Rear Turn Lamp UsageStop and TurnNot Used
Rear LED Turn OutageEnabledDisabled


For Oracle Tail Lights With Amber Drop Ins:

FunctionOriginal ValueNew Value
Left Rear Stop and Position Lamp UsageNot UsedStop Only
Left Rear Turn Lamp UsageStop and TurnTurn Only
Right Rear Stop and Position Lamp UsageNot UsedStop Only
Right Rear Turn Lamp UsageStop and TurnTurn Only
Rear LED Turn OutageEnabledDisabled

Sorry for the confusion yes this is correct. However, I do want to point out that for the amber drop ins, all the settings above should already be set besides the "Rear LED Turn Outage" setting. On a Bronco equipped with the LED Signature Lamps, that is the only setting that needs to be changed. If you already made changes and installed the Flush Tails and are adding in the amber drop ins after the fact, you just need to make sure all your settings match the table above.

I don't believe that is true. I documented my Bronco's Original values in the Original Value's column. I purchased, received, and installed my Oracle lights with Ambers at the same time. I never did any programming until they were both installed.

You'll need to program your settings from the table above, or they aren't going to work right.

For the rubber stop I went to my O'Reilly's-bought tray of various rubber bumpers and found that one in particular is literally a perfect fit with minimal trimming. You will need an exacto-type blade, however to make it work. When finished, you can use the same exact bump stop for both the top and bottom of the driver side. Although the top bolt is a little shorter than it could be, you will still get enough engagement of the threads using the more robust rubber stop with no risk of the bolt backing out. I imagine that the folks who use just the tubing that number one it's going to be tough to get the light aligned with the body panels and number two that eventually the bolt is going to shake its way out. Unveiled for the world to see at SEMA 2023, Galpin Auto Sports’ Ford Bronco is a one-of-a-kind off-roader that captures the essence of both the Bronco’s heritage and the musical magic of Imagine Dragons. The collaboration between GAS and the band resulted in a remarkable vehicle that seamlessly marries the world of music and automotive artistry.

The Imagine Dragons-inspired Bronco is based on the rugged Badlands four-door model. What sets it apart is its unique and nostalgic styling. The design team at GAS drew inspiration from the older Broncos, giving this modern off-roader a retro touch. At the front, you’ll find a Ranger-style grille and badging, paying homage to the Bronco’s heritage. The standard wheels have been swapped for custom aluminum wheels from Fifteen52, finished in a striking gold color that complements the Eruption Green metallic paintwork. These wheels are wrapped in rugged 37-inch Toyo Open Country M/T tires, ensuring this Bronco is ready to conquer any terrain.

The gold accents extend to the detachable roof and the grille, creating a harmonious contrast with the vibrant Eruption Green. The vehicle not only boasts stunning looks but also impressive off-road capabilities. To enhance its performance in challenging terrains, GAS has equipped the Bronco with a 2.5-inch Camburg suspension lift kit and Bilstein shocks. These modifications make it clear that this Bronco is not just a showpiece; it’s a true off-road warrior.
